 The rise of meme coins including Kimba The White Lion Coin has also contributed to a psychological shift among cryptocurrency investors. As more people become involved in the market, driven by the allure of quick profits, their decisions are increasingly influenced by emotional responses rather than rational investment strategies. This shift in behavior is especially apparent in the speculative trading of meme coins, where investors often buy and sell based on hype, social media trends, and fear of missing out (FOMO).

 

As meme coins capture the attention of the broader public, Bitcoin investors may begin to feel a sense of urgency or competition. The rapid gains seen in meme coins may lead some to question whether Bitcoin is underperforming, potentially causing them to reconsider their investment in favor of the more volatile, but seemingly more exciting, meme coins. This psychological pressure can lead to sudden sell-offs in Bitcoin, which may result in short-term price fluctuations. As a result, meme coins indirectly affect Bitcoin prices through the psychology of investor decision-making.

 

The rise of meme coins has captivated the cryptocurrency world, with many questioning their influence on established c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in. Meme coins, often created as a joke or for entertainment purposes, have seen a meteoric rise in popularity, attracting both seasoned investors and newcomers to the market. Among these coins, Dogecoin and Shiba Inu are the most well-known, and their success has sparked widespread discussions about the potential impact of meme coins on Bitcoin's price and overall market dynamics. While meme coins are typically volatile and less reliable in terms of long-term value, their influence on market trends and investor behavior cannot be overlooked.
